How do I put a background on my 3ds?
Add a background image: Open the Rendering menu and choose Environment to open the Environment And Effects dialog. On the Common Parameters rollout, click the Environment Map button (at present, the text on the button says (“None”). 3ds Max opens the Material/Map Browser.

WHAT IS environment in 3ds Max?
The Environment section in V-Ray render parameters is where you can specify a color and a texture map to be used during GI and reflection/refraction calculations. If you don’t specify a color/map then the background color and map specified in the 3ds Max Environment dialog will be used by default.
Why is 3ds Max rendering black?
Causes: Rendering > Render Setup > Effects > Photographic exposure settings may be turned On or are set inappropriately for the scene’s render engine and/or lighting setup. Gamma correction may be turned Off in the 3ds Max preferences, resulting in dark-appearing test renders.

How do you render a background in SketchUp?
Here’s how it works:
- Select Window > Styles.
- In the Styles panel, select the Edit tab and then click the Watermark Settings icon ( ).
- Click the Add Watermark icon ( ).
- In the Choose Watermark dialog box that appears, navigate to the image you want to use as a background.

Where is environment and effects 3ds Max?
In 3ds Max press 8 or go to Rendering > Environment…. Environment and Effects menu will show up.
